Python庫的導入與管理方法有以下幾種:
直接導入:使用import
語句導入整個庫。例如:import math
導入特定函數或類:使用from
語句導入庫中的特定函數或類。例如:from math import sqrt
導入并重命名:使用import
語句導入庫,并給它指定一個新的名稱。例如:import numpy as np
導入全部內容:使用from
語句導入庫中的全部內容。例如:from math import *
導入子模塊:某些庫擁有多個子模塊,可以使用點號(.)來導入子模塊。例如:import os.path
動態導入:在運行時根據條件動態地導入庫。例如:if condition: import module1 else: import module2
Python庫的管理方法主要有以下幾種:
使用pip工具:pip是Python的包管理工具,可以用來安裝、升級和卸載庫。例如:pip install numpy
使用conda工具:如果使用Anaconda Python發行版,可以使用conda來管理庫。例如:conda install numpy
手動安裝:可以從庫的官方網站下載庫的源代碼,然后使用命令行或IDE將其安裝到Python環境中。
使用虛擬環境:虛擬環境可以用來隔離不同項目的庫,避免庫的版本沖突。可以使用Python內置的venv模塊或者第三方工具如virtualenv來創建虛擬環境。
總之,Python庫的導入與管理方法非常靈活,可以根據具體的需求選擇適合的方法。